Quantification of phenolphthalein in cosmetic products

Abstract
A simple method for the quantification of phenolphthalein in cosmetic
formulations is described. The sample, acidified with acetic acid,
is extracted with methanol and analysed by reversed-phase HPLC on a
column packed with 5 m SelectB RP-8. The initial mobile phase is
acetonitrile-aqueous 0.1 M acetic acid (10:90), then a linear gradient
up to 90% acetonitrile is applied in 30 min. The limit of determination
is 1 ng injected when detection is performed at 230 nm.
